Top Checklist To Maximize Resale Value Before Selling Asus Zenfone 11 Ultra

Preparing your Asus Zenfone 11 Ultra for resale involves several key steps to ensure you get the best value. A well-maintained device not only attracts more buyers but also commands a higher price. Follow this comprehensive checklist to maximize your resale value.

1. Clean and Physically Inspect the Device

Start by thoroughly cleaning your Zenfone 11 Ultra. Use a soft, lint-free cloth to wipe the screen, back, and sides. Remove any fingerprints, smudges, or dirt. Check for scratches, dents, or cracks. Address minor cosmetic issues if possible, such as using screen protectors or cases to hide imperfections.

2. Backup and Reset the Device

Backup all important data, including photos, contacts, and app data. Once backed up, perform a factory reset to erase personal information. This protects your privacy and provides the new owner with a clean device.

3. Check Hardware and Functionality

Test all hardware components: screen responsiveness, camera functionality, speakers, microphone, charging port, and buttons. Ensure Wi-Fi, Bluetooth, and cellular connectivity work properly. Address any issues by repairing or replacing faulty parts if possible.

4. Gather Original Accessories and Packaging

Locate the original box, charger, USB cable, earphones, and any other accessories that came with the device. Including these items can boost the resale value and attract more buyers.

5. Check for Software Updates and Reset

Ensure the device runs the latest firmware version for optimal performance. After updating, perform a final reset to ensure the device is in pristine condition for the new owner.

6. Take High-Quality Photos

Capture clear, well-lit photos from multiple angles. Highlight the device’s condition, including any cosmetic features or accessories. Good photos significantly increase buyer interest.

7. Set a Competitive Price

Research current market prices for the Asus Zenfone 11 Ultra in similar condition. Price competitively to attract buyers quickly while ensuring you get a fair value.

8. Write an Honest and Detailed Listing

Provide a comprehensive description of your device, including specifications, condition, accessories included, and any issues. Transparency builds trust and reduces potential disputes.

9. Choose a Reliable Selling Platform

Select reputable online marketplaces or local selling options. Platforms like eBay, Swappa, or Facebook Marketplace offer good exposure and secure transactions.

10. Final Tips for a Successful Sale

Respond promptly to inquiries, be honest about the device’s condition, and arrange secure payment and shipping methods. A smooth transaction ensures positive feedback and a higher resale reputation.
